5 CSR 25-500.082 Physical Requirements of Group Day Care Homes and Day Care Centers
Violation
 Provider Comments
Violation
Diapering requirements were not met as evidenced by the diapering table was not safe in that the pad on the table was not secure to the table. .
Licensing Rule Reference
5 CSR 25-500.082 Physical Requirements of Group Day Care Homes and Day Care Centers (4) (A) states: A safe diapering table with a waterproof washable surface shall be used for changing diapers. The diapering table shall be located within or adjacent to the group space so the caregiver using the diapering table can maintain supervision of his/her group of children at all times.
Correction Required
The facility shall provide a safe and clean diapering table as required.

Correction Verification
Corrected on Site

Compliance Date
8/29/2022

5 CSR 25-500.102 Personnel
Violation
 Provider Comments
Violation
Safe sleep training was not completed within the past 3 years for the following staff Rayna Young, Jasmine Steiner, Jennie Sanders, Marisa Meritt, Zoe Forrest, Desiree Curtin, Barbara Millard.
Licensing Rule Reference
5 CSR 25-500.102 Personnel (4) . states: Safe Sleep Training. Every three (3) years the center director, group child care home provider, all other caregivers, and those volunteers who are counted in staff/child ratios in a group child care home or child care center licensed to provide care for infants less than one (1) year of age shall successfully complete department-approved training regarding the American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) safe sleep recommendations contained in the American Academy of Pediatrics Task Force on Sudden Infant Death Syndrome. Technical report – SIDS and other sleep-related infant deaths: Updated 2016 Recommendations for a Safe Infant Sleeping Environment, by Moon RY, which is incorporated by reference in this rule as published in PEDIATRICS Volume 138, No. 5, November 1, 2016 and available at http://pediatrics.aappublications.org/content/pediatrics/early/2016/10/20/peds.2016-2938.full.pdf. This rule does not incorporate any subsequent amendments or additions.
Correction Required
The director, group home provider, other caregivers, and those volunteers counted in staff/child ratio, shall complete department approved safe sleep training as required.

Correction Verification
Submit Documentation

Compliance Date

5 CSR 25-500.122 Medical Examination Reports
Violation
 Provider Comments
Violation
A medical examination report did not include either a Risk Assessment for Tuberculosis form or a negative tuberculin skin test (TST for the following staff: Kaitlyn Hotchkin (doctor did not sign TBRA form).
Licensing Rule Reference
5 CSR 25-500.122 Medical Examination Reports (1) (B) . states: Medical examination reports shall include either a Tuberculosis (TB) Risk Assessment form, completed and signed by a health care professional, or a negative tuberculin skin test (TST) completed not more than twelve (12) months before beginning work in the facility. The Tuberculosis (TB) Risk Assessment form, revised March 2014, is incorporated by reference in this rule, as published by the Missouri Department of Health and Senior Services, PO Box 570, Jefferson City, MO 65102 and available by the Missouri Department of Health and Senior Services at https://health.mo.gov/living/healthcondiseases/communicable/tuberculosis/tbmanual/pdf/RiskAssessmentform.pdf. If the person has signs or symptoms of tuberculosis, or risk factors for tuberculosis, then testing for tuberculosis shall occur.
Correction Required
Medical examination reports shall include Risk Assessment for Tuberculosis forms or negative tuberulin skin test (TST) as required.

Correction Verification
Submit Documentation

Compliance Date
